RESPONSIBILITIES – TASKS
Production & Process Control
Supervise daily operations of the nitrile dipping line—including coagulant mix preparation, pre-wash, dipping, leaching, drying, and curing stages.
Monitor critical process parameters (CTP’s~ bath temperature, dwell times, polymer viscosity, line speed) and adjust controls to maintain consistent film thickness and tensile properties.
Implement standard operating procedures (SOPs) for NBR compound handling, bath replenishment, and line changeovers.
Monitor the dipping process parameters and make necessary adjustments to maintain product standards.
Coordinate raw material usage (nitrile latex, accelerators, coagulants, leaching chemicals) to optimize consumption and reduce waste.
Quality Assurance
Enforce in-line quality checks (e.g., gauge tests, leak tests, tensile/elongation sampling) to ensure compliance with customer and regulatory specs (e.g., ASTM D6319, EN 455).
Partner with QC lab to root-cause defects (pinholes, surface irregularities) and implement corrective actions or recipe optimizations.
Maintain records of production parameters and quality data for traceability and audits
Team Leadership & Training
Plan shift rosters and assign operators for each dipping stage.
Train new hires and upskill existing staff on nitrile chemistry fundamentals, process safety (chemical exposures, heat), and contamination control.
Coach and mentor team members, conduct performance reviews, and drive a culture of accountability.
